Garage floor installation services involve preparing and laying down durable surfaces in residential and commercial garages. This process typically includes removing the existing flooring, repairing any underlying damage, and applying a new, long-lasting surface such as concrete, epoxy coating, or specialized tiles. Skilled contractors ensure the foundation is solid and the finished floor is level, smooth, and resistant to stains, cracks, and wear. Proper installation not only enhances the appearance of the garage but also provides a safer, more functional space for vehicle storage, hobbies, or additional storage needs.

Many common problems can be addressed through professional garage floor installation. Cracked, uneven, or stained floors can pose safety hazards and diminish the overall look of the space. Moisture seepage and underlying structural issues may also cause damage over time if not properly repaired. Installing a new garage floor can help solve these problems by creating a sealed, stable surface that resists damage from spills, chemicals, and temperature fluctuations. This upgrade can extend the lifespan of the garage and reduce ongoing maintenance costs.

The overview below groups typical Garage Floor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Minor crack repairs and surface refinishing typically cost between $250 and $600. Many routine jobs fall within this range, depending on the extent of damage and surface area involved.

Standard Garage Floor Coatings - Applying a new epoxy or coating usually ranges from $1,000 to $3,000 for most residential projects. Most projects in this category are completed within this band, with fewer reaching higher costs for additional customization.

Full Garage Floor Replacement - Complete removal and replacement of existing concrete can cost between $3,500 and $7,000. Larger, more complex projects can exceed this range, but many are completed within the mid-tier prices.

Custom or Decorative Finishes - Specialty finishes such as stamped or colored concrete may range from $4,000 to $10,000 or more. These projects are less common and tend to be on the higher end of the cost spectrum, depending on design complexity.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of garage floor surfaces can local contractors install? They can install a variety of surfaces including epoxy coatings, concrete overlays, and interlocking tiles to suit different preferences and needs.

Are garage floor installations suitable for residential properties? Yes, local service providers often handle installations for residential garages, ensuring a durable and attractive surface.

What preparation is needed before installing a garage floor coating? Typically, the existing concrete surface needs to be cleaned, repaired for cracks or damages, and properly prepared to ensure proper adhesion of the new coating.

Can local contractors customize garage floor designs? Many service providers offer options for customizing colors, patterns, and finishes to match personal style or existing garage aesthetics.

What maintenance is required after a garage floor installation? Maintenance usually involves regular cleaning and occasional resealing, depending on the type of surface installed by local contractors.
